SpringBoot 分为四层:controller层、service层、dao层、model层controller层:控制层,存放各种控制器,来提供数据或者返回界面,实现对Get和Post的相应,用于前后端交互,service层和前端通过Controller层进行数据交互。导入service层,调用service方法,controller通过接收前端传过来的参数进行业务操作,在返回个指定的路径
# Java Spring Boot 导入的一般设计 Java Spring Boot 是个开源的Java框架,用于快速构建独立的、可扩展的和生产级的Java应用程序。Spring Boot 提供了种便捷的方式来搭建和配置Java应用程序,同时也集成了许多常用的依赖库和工具,使得开发人员能够更加专注于业务逻辑的实现。 在设计个Java Spring Boot 项目时,我们首先需要确定项目
原创 11月前
32阅读
开始先给大家讲个故事:客户要做个内部办公系统项目项目包含了 前台接待,员工管理,财务结算,库存管理 然后,我们块做,做完上线。过了段时间,某个功能需要修改,于是你们块改改改,上线时,所有功能都暂停使用20分钟,更新版本。再过了段时间,财务结算需要修改,于是又改改改,上线时,又暂停20分钟,更新版本。时间过去了,客户又提出,,,,,客户开始抱怨了,我只是要改某个模块,每次都要所有
转载 5月前
367阅读
Springboot项目开发完成后要做的工作就是部署了,这里记录下打包部署的过程。这个项目SpringBoot多模块项目,包含了个父工程,个子模块和个工具模块。其中子模块里有启动类,而工具模块没有。因此这三者的pom文件不样。1. 打包1.1 准备用Idea加载开发好的springboot项目。目录结构截图如下:修改配置文件,按生成环境prod配置相关的redis,mysql参数,不
1.课程介绍 1. Spring Boot简介;(了解) 2. Spring Boot入门;(了解) 3. Spring Boot简介web;(掌握) 4. Spring Boot测试;(掌握) 5. Spring Boot三层架构;(掌握) 6. Spring Boot 持久化;(掌握) 7. Spring boot模块化开发;(掌握) 2.Spring Boot简介 2.1.什
开发环境:后端:开发语言:Java框架:springbootJDK版本:JDK1.8服务器:tomcat8数据库:mysql 5.7+数据库工具:Navicat11开发软件:eclipse/ideaMaven包:Maven3.3+前端:nodejs,vue数据库:mysql系统架构: 系统中的功能模块主要是:管理员权限:首页、个人中心、学生管理、教师管理、问题发布管理、疑难解答管理
这段时间学习了下后端Java开发,使用到了springboot框架,才知道spring boot框架里面层层分明,觉得很有意思,感觉可以记录下!以方便后面自己加深理解和新学习的同学起共同学习!  springboot工程要包含有的package包二、核心内置导入包三、package包当中每个包的实现功能1、entity层2、service层3、controller层4
职称一般怎么填?软考相关指南 在进行软考报名或者填写相关表格时,职称是项重要的内容。对于软考人员来说,正确地填写职称不仅关系到报名的成功与否,还可能影响到个人的职业发展。那么,职称一般怎么填呢?本文将为您提供详细的指南。 首先,我们需要了解软考职称的基本分类。软考职称主要包括初级、中级和高级三个等级。其中,初级职称包括助理工程师、技术员等;中级职称包括工程师、高级工程师等;高级职称则包括正高
原创 9月前
126阅读
DataTable dt = new DataTable("Users");            dt.Columns.Add("PK", typeof(int));            dt.Columns.Add("#", typeof(int));   row1["Popularity"]=0;            dt.Rows.Add(row1);     ublic static
转载 2010-12-07 09:13:00
318阅读
2评论
在此总结下如题。。在思考个表最基本。。必要的方法。。 假设建表user 它用有两个字段 id userName userPass (不能再少了,我还没见过,个表里就个id 的。
原创 2022-08-29 16:52:11
261阅读
DevOps这个词在IT行业中越来越常见,但是很多人对它的发音却存在不少分歧。那么,究竟DevOps一般怎么读呢? 实际上,DevOps可以读作“dev-ops”或者“dee-vee-ops”,其中前者更为常见。这个术语其实是Development(开发)和Operations(运维)两个单词的结合,旨在强调开发团队和运维团队之间的紧密合作和沟通。在过去,开发和运维两个部门通常是独立的,导致了软
原创 5月前
131阅读
  ------------------------------------------------------------------------------有关清晰概念的学习方法:1. 先凭个人理解去认识
原创 2022-12-16 17:12:22
90阅读
软考项目一般管理是软件行业中的重要环节,它涵盖了项目从启动到收尾的整个过程,确保项目能够按时、按质、按量完成。在软考中,项目管理知识是必考内容之,对于软件从业人员来说,掌握项目管理的理念和方法至关重要。 在软考项目一般管理中,首先需要明确项目的目标和范围。项目目标是项目实施的导向,它决定了项目的方向和最终成果。项目范围则是明确项目需要完成的具体工作内容,避免项目过程中出现范围蔓延导致无法按时交
、前言创建多媒体定时器和读文档功能的应用。二、技术实现        首先要包含MMSystem.h头文件,还要添加以下代码 #pragma comment(lib,"winmm.lib")创建多媒体定时器由四个函数合作完成:执行创建:CreateTimer();执行回调:TimeProc();执行内容:OnTime
# Java项目开发中的难点解析及代码示例 Java作为种广泛使用的编程语言,其在项目开发过程中会遇到各种各样的难点。本文将探讨Java项目开发中的些常见难点,并提供相应的代码示例和旅行图来帮助读者更好地理解。 ## Java项目开发难点概述 在Java项目开发中,开发者可能会遇到以下难点: 1. **内存管理**:Java使用垃圾回收机制来管理内存,但开发者仍需注意内存泄漏问题。 2
原创 1月前
20阅读
# Java项目打包之jar文件 在Java开发过程中,通常会需要将项目打包成个可执行的jar文件,以便于部署和运行。本文将介绍如何打包一般的Java项目,并生成jar文件。 ## 准备工作 在打包之前,需要确保项目已经编译通过,并且所有的依赖库已经添加到项目中。一般来说,Java项目都会使用Maven或Gradle等构建工具管理依赖,确保在打包时所有的依赖都能正确引入。 ## 打包
原创 4月前
30阅读
## Java项目QPS一般多少 作为名经验丰富的开发者,我很乐意向你解释如何实现Java项目的QPS计算。在开始之前,让我们明确下QPS的概念。QPS(Queries Per Second)表示每秒查询次数,用于衡量系统的并发处理能力。在Java项目中,通过些技术手段和工具可以计算出QPS值,从而评估系统的性能。 ### 实现流程 下面是实现Java项目QPS计算的流程,通过以下步骤
原创 9月前
132阅读
1、缓存String类型例如:热点数据缓存(例如报表、明星出轨),对象缓存、全页缓存、可以提升热点数据的访问数据。2、数据共享分布式String 类型,因为 Redis 是分布式的独立服务,可以在多个应用之间共享例如:分布式Session<dependency> <groupId>org.springframework.session</groupId>
转载 2023-07-09 23:43:59
42阅读
在不使用 SpringBoot 的时候,如果我们需要个类必须要将它放到 Spring 的容器中,但是使用了 SpringBoot 之后就算我们不配置,仅仅是导入 jar 包就可以直接从容器中获取类了,这是怎么实现的呢?基于 SpringBoot 2.2.0.RELEASE 版本下面介绍帮助 SB 实现自动装配的 最关键 的四个注解或类。SpringBootApplication首先每个 Spri
转载 2月前
19阅读
随着人工智能和机器学习的持续升温,Python目前是首选的AI语言,在数据科学和AI中占据主导地位,而且随着互联网的发展,Python的应用越来越广泛,学习Python的人也越来越多,主要是因为Python门槛低,上手很快,而且通用性和实用性都比Java和C++更有灵活性,学习起来会更加简单。那么学习Python需要多长时间呢?
转载 2023-08-06 13:01:27
246阅读
  • 1
  • 2
  • 3
  • 4
  • 5